NAME¶
RDF::Trine::Store::DBI::SQLite - SQLite subclass of DBI store
VERSION¶
This document describes RDF::Trine::Store::DBI::SQLite version 1.019
SYNOPSIS¶
use RDF::Trine::Store::DBI::SQLite;
my $store = RDF::Trine::Store->new({
storetype => 'DBI',
name => 'test',
dsn => "dbi:SQLite:dbname=test.db",
username => '',
password => ''
});
CHANGES IN VERSION 1.014¶
The schema used to encode RDF data in SQLite changed in RDF::Trine version 1.014
to fix a bug that was causing data loss. This change is not backwards
compatible, and is not compatible with the shared schema used by the other
database backends supported by RDF::Trine (PostgreSQL and MySQL).
To exchange data between SQLite and other databases, the data will
require export to an RDF serialization and re-import to the new
database.
METHODS¶
Beyond the methods documented below, this class inherits methods from the
RDF::Trine::Store::DBI class.
- "new_with_config ( \%config )"
- Returns a new RDF::Trine::Store object based on the supplied configuration
hashref.
- "init"
- Creates the necessary tables in the underlying database.
AUTHOR¶
Gregory Todd Williams
"<gwilliams@cpan.org>"
COPYRIGHT¶
Copyright (c) 2006-2012 Gregory Todd Williams. This program is free software;
you can redistribute it and/or modify it under the same terms as Perl itself.